
During June 2026, contributed to the z2586300277/three-cesium-examples repository by developing three advanced visualization features for geospatial applications. Work centered on implementing volumetric cloud rendering as a post-processing stage in Cesium, enabling dynamic weather simulation through custom GLSL shaders and JavaScript. Developed a viewshed analysis tool that leverages WebGL shaders for shadow mapping and sensor simulation, supporting spatial analysis within 3D globe environments. Additionally, created a dynamic water surface effect with real-time parameter adjustment using dat.GUI. These features enhanced the repository’s capabilities for business-focused geospatial demos, demonstrating depth in 3D graphics programming and frontend development with CesiumJS.
